Abstract
AIM: We performed a replication study in a Japanese population to evaluate the association between type 2 diabetes and six susceptibility loci (TMEM154, SSR1, FAF1, POU5F1, ARL15, and MPHOSPH9) originally identified by a transethnic meta-analysis of genome-wide association studies (GWAS) in 2014.Entities:

Association of 6 SNP loci with type 2 diabetes in a Japanese population.
| SNP | Nearby gene | Risk Allele | RAF | Unadjusted | Adjusted | ||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| OR(95%CI) | OR (95%CI) | ||||||
| rs6813195 | C | 0.47 | 0.062 | 1.075 (0.996–1.159) | 0.096 | 1.077 (0.987–1.174) | |
| rs9505118 | A | 0.56 | 0.935 | 0.997 (0.924–1.075) | 0.513 | 0.971 (0.890–1.060) | |
| rs17106184 | G | 0.90 | 0.589 | 1.037 (0.909–1.183) | 0.616 | 1.040 (0.893–1.210) | |
| rs3130501 | G | 0.57 | 0.012 | 1.103 (1.021–1.191) | 0.017 | 1.113 (1.019–1.215) | |
| rs702634 | A | 0.82 | 0.962 | 1.002 (0.908–1.107) | 0.848 | 0.989 (0.883–1.108) | |
| rs4275659 | C | 0.67 | 0.010 | 1.114 (1.027–1.209) | 0.012 | 1.127 (1.026–1.238) | |
| GRS | 2.4×10−3 | 1.056 (1.020–1.094) | 0.014 | 1.052 (1.010–1.095) | |||
The results of logistic regression analysis are shown.
a Risk allele reported in the original trans-ethnic GWAS.
b Adjusted for age, sex and BMI.
c The genetic risk score (GRS) was calculated according to the number of risk alleles by counting the 6 trans-ethnic genome-wide association study derived SNPs
d Individuals who had complete genotype data for 6 SNPs (n = 7,293) were used for the analyses
